While we're all watching American shows, there are British gems we should discover, like this one! I've discovered the show over the last weekend and have almost finished the 16 episodes. (A third season as been comissioned.) 

Fresh Meat is a dramedy about Manchester university freshmen who share an off-campus house because they didn't get rooms in student housing. (From left to right:) Good-girl Josie, who starts her first term under the wrong guy. Geology student Howard from Scotland who likes to blow-dry meat. Mysterious Oregon from, who… is something else. Rich kid JP, who would prefer a maid over flatmates. Ordinary Kingsley – who'se face you might have seen on Inbetweeners – who looks to talk to his neighbor Josie via a glory hole between their rooms. And finally Vod, who is neither a lesbian nor a motivated student.

The show shows all their misfortunes during their first and second term.

A great watch, if you like… Misfits, Skins, college movies.
